I put them in a glass with some water in and then place the glas in a heated propegator it gets around 80 degrees in the propogator and the temp is pretty stable trougouth the entire day because . When i started I would just put them in the soil and all of them would pop and become healthy seeds since i started growing again i have used rockwool cubes, rootit plugs and jiffys but getting them to pop works best in a glas of water in my opinon and then transplant in presoaked rockwool.

I knew a guy on a different forum and he would throw his seeds in a pan and heat them a bit until they popped worked great for him but i dont know if its cost effective if you buy premium seeds. people also have allots of succes with peroxide i gues the extra oxygen helps protect the tine fresh root against rot.
I use 10 drops peroxide to a cup of water soak seeds overnight fold a paper towell to a 4in square get it wet not sopping wet, put the seed in the center put it in a baggie, insert the temp probe then put the baggie on the heat mat set at 80°. Usually pops in 24 hrs if it don't it set it at 85. 100% germination. Once germed I put it in a peat pot of well cooked super soil

Regs isn't just about breeding. And there's nothing wrong with fems either. Being open to regs just adds more variety and a lot of good breeders. And of course some strains you can only find in regs. It does suck growing plants 2-3 feet just to kill some of them. But if it's exactly the genetics I'm after from a reputable breeder I dont mind it that way. Just something I dont like about the generic big brand breeders. Like some of these places claim to have a lot of the classics but where did they actually get it from... Is that the REAL durban poison or Chemdog, white widow etc they claim to have. And then some of these strains are too convoluted for me. Like "Snowblower #1 (Sour Snow x Glue Sniffer) x Snowblower #2". Is just too snazzy for me. I'm out. I'll stick with my tried and true Northern lights#2 and Death Star x sensi star, Super silver haze, skunk, cheese, Urkle, Forbidden fruit. Legends. Not just whatever looks and sounds cool. I dont have time to grow "whatever sounds cool". I like proven legendary milestones crossed with other proven legendary milestones.
I just don't have the time or space, I do 6 plants in a spare bedroom tent, if half (or more) end up male I waste resources for the rest of the run so it's just not for me.
